Output 81d0e6b8397ab640c156e47a1d6aa834bcde6a24b0da334ba7f9768786912325:2
- value
- 28143791
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ec8e51335a48acf941bfe5cd0478df3fd5a36241 OP_EQUAL
- address
- 3PFotBpnsCJ3RKjnH6bQ7B9MdJJKjhH9Jq
- transaction
- 81d0e6b8397ab640c156e47a1d6aa834bcde6a24b0da334ba7f9768786912325
- spent
- true